Tahtalı Dağı, also known as Lycian Olympus, is a mountain near Kemer, a seaside resort on the Turkish Riviera in Antalya Province, Turkey. It was known as Olympus and Phoenicus or Phoinikous in ancient times. Tahtalı Dağı is situated 3½ km north of Taş.

Ulupınar is a neighbourhood of the municipality and district of Kemer, Antalya Province, Turkey. Its population is 1,315. It is situated 25 kilometres from the district centre of Kemer. Ulupınar is situated 6 km south of Taş.
